Nebulization twice a day for a perod of 3 days(Dose: 2.5 ml arka for Nebulisation).
Children with mild to moderate exacerbation of asthma will be included.
Children in whom parents are willing to participate their child in the study and ready to sign the informed ascent form will be included.
Children less than 6 years and more than 10 years will be excluded.
Children with History of or presenting with Tuberculosis, COPD, emphysema, chronic airway limitation, severe upper airway obstruction or any anatomical defects of respiratory tract will be excluded.
